Exclusive: Samsung's 25W Magnetic Wireless Charger Leaked, Likely for Galaxy S26

Samsung appears poised to significantly upgrade its wireless charging capabilities with a new 25W Qi2 charger, exclusive images reveal. The device, likely intended for the upcoming Galaxy S26 series, represents a notable leap from current 15W wireless charging standards in Samsung's ecosystem.

Design and Specifications

The charger, identified by model number EP-P2900BBEGWW and marketed as the Magnetic Wireless Charger, features a circular magnetic charging puck connected via a nylon-braided USB Type-C cable. Its design aligns with contemporary Qi2 chargers from various manufacturers, emphasizing a clean, functional aesthetic. The unit clearly displays "Qi2 25W" branding, confirming its maximum output capability.

To achieve its full 25W charging speed, Samsung recommends pairing the wireless charger with a 45W USB Power Delivery adapter. This suggests the company is optimizing for faster wireless charging experiences, though the actual speed will depend heavily on device compatibility.

Device Compatibility and Speed Tiers

The charger's capabilities appear to be tiered based on the receiving device. The Galaxy S26 Ultra is expected to support the full 25W wireless charging speed, making it the primary beneficiary of this new technology. Meanwhile, the standard Galaxy S26 and Galaxy S26+ may be limited to 20W wireless charging with the same charger.

For older Qi2-certified Samsung devices, including the Galaxy S25 and Galaxy Z Fold 7, compatibility exists but with reduced performance. These devices are reportedly limited to 15W wireless charging when using this new 25W charger, maintaining parity with their original specifications.

Market Context and Implications

The introduction of a 25W wireless charger represents Samsung's continued investment in charging technology, particularly as competitors advance their own wireless solutions. The magnetic alignment feature, standard in Qi2 devices, should improve placement accuracy and charging efficiency compared to traditional Qi wireless chargers.

This development suggests Samsung is preparing the Galaxy S26 series, particularly the Ultra model, for significantly faster wireless charging than previous generations. The tiered compatibility approach indicates strategic differentiation between device models, with the Ultra variant potentially receiving exclusive premium features.
